Mabel Sylvia LeBoeuf

January 12, 2002

LeBoeuf - Mabel Sylvia of Courtenay, formerly of Kamloops, passed away peacefully on Saturday, January 12, 2002 at Glacier View Lodge, age 82. Predeceased by her parents Marino and Emma Indseth and by her twin sister Myrtle Stevenson and her sisters: Agnes East, Margaret Mortenson, Evelyn Haga and brothers: Perry and Clare Indseth, and by her infant daughter JoAnne Evelyn; she will be lovingly remembered and sadly missed by her daughters: Denise Neifer of Black Creek, and Donna Flaman of Savona, B.C.; and by her grandchildren: Lisa and Chuck Noel, Cheryl and Mikey Zanchetta, Jenny Neifer and Joel Neifer, Tricia Merry, Michelle Merry, and Josh Flaman; and by her great-grandchildren: Melissa and Steven Noel, Ashley, Taylor and Nore Zanchetta, Elizabeth, Ayla, Austin, Jazmine and Jacob Neifer. Also survived by her sister-in-law Marianne Indseth (Clare) and special friends Victor and Marion Bradford of Kamloops and by many nieces and nephews who she held very dear to her heart.


Born in Webb, Saskatchewan, went to school in Climax, Saskatchewan, Mabel spent many years in Kamloops where she worked and raised her two daughters before retiring to Vancouver Island in 1992. She loved to garden, bake and spend fun times with her many grandchildren and great-grandchildren who will really miss their “Nanny”. Special heartfelt thanks to the staff at Glacier View Lodge.
